Our Story

In 1978, Ron Newcomer and Bill Wynn opened Xenia Coin Shop on West Second Street. What started in a building that had been an arcade and pizza parlor became something more enduring: a place where generations of collectors, families, and community members would turn for honest dealing and expert guidance.

In 2018, Ryan Davis took ownership, committed to preserving what made Xenia Coin special: same location, same values, same dedication to treating people fairly.

The People Behind the Counter

Ryan Davis earned his finance degree from the University of Cincinnati, but it was a childhood fascination with coins that shaped his career path. A professional numismatist since 2011 and Vice President of the American Numismatic Association, Ryan brings both market expertise and genuine passion for helping people understand the value and story behind their collections.

He represents a new generation of leadership built on the same foundation of integrity that's defined this shop for four decades.

Tumultuous Times

During the 2020 shutdown, we stayed open as an essential financial service, helping people convert precious metals to cash when they needed it most. Today, we're one of the few remaining coin shops in the greater Dayton area. Through the good times and bad, we'll be here.
